Mom-of-Pearl Containers: Exquisite Craftsmanship
Mother-of-pearl containers constitute A different legendary Egyptian craft. These exquisitely crafted objects are made by inlaying shimmering pieces of mom-of-pearl into wood to make intricate geometric styles. These containers, typically useful for storing jewellery or trinkets, are certainly not basically practical; They're functions of artwork that increase a contact of magnificence to any space.
Gold and Silver Cartouches: Individualized Luxury
One of the most unique goods you may encounter in Egypt are personalised cartouches. These classic pendants, shaped like an elongated oval, aspect hieroglyphic inscriptions with the wearer's name or that of the beloved a single. Crafted from gold or silver, cartouches keep deep symbolic significance, featuring a personal link to Egypt's ancient heritage.
